Former IBF bantamweight champion Joseph Agbeko has told Joy Sports, Referee Russel Mora who officiated his controversial defeat to Abner Mares should be banned from the sport.
The 31-year-old suffered a lot of low punches from Mares in the world title fight but referee Mora failed to even caution let alone deduct points from the Mexican.
Agbeko told JOY Sports' Nathaniel Attoh, “I want him to be banned. I don’t think he deserves to be in this game because he can kill in the ring. You can’t trust him with anyone's life.”
He added that, “Right now I am trying to forget what happened last week. I want to put it behind me and focus on December.”
Agbeko protested the unanimous points decision and has been handed a rematch after the worldwide condemnation of US ring officials' role in the bout.
